Pokémon Scarlet & Violet has now become the second-best-selling game in the franchise’s nearly 30-year history, reaching an impressive 26.79 million units sold worldwide, according to new data shared by Serebii.
This milestone cements the ninth-generation titles as a landmark moment for the Pokémon series. Not only did Scarlet & Violet introduce the franchise’s first fully open-world experience, but it also managed to surpass the sales of Sword & Shield, the previous generation on Nintendo Switch.
The only titles to have sold more remain the original Pokémon Red & Blue, which launched the franchise into global stardom in the late 1990s.
Despite performance issues and bugs at launch, Scarlet & Violet resonated strongly with fans thanks to its freedom-focused gameplay, fresh setting in the Paldea region, and a bold step away from the linear design of previous games.
As the Scarlet & Violet era winds down, attention now turns to what’s next. While Generation 10 has yet to be announced, The Pokémon Company recently revealed a new spin-off set for release later this year: Pokémon Legends: Z-A.
Set in Lumiose City, this upcoming title will bring back the much-loved Mega Evolution mechanic, which originally debuted in Pokémon X & Y. Reports suggest this revival won’t be limited to Z-A alone—it’s expected to impact multiple branches of the Pokémon universe, including:
Pokémon Go
The Pokémon TCG Pocket mobile app
The physical trading card game, which has already confirmed Mega Pokémon will feature in future card sets
With 2026 marking Pokémon’s 30th anniversary, fans and analysts alike are expecting a major celebration. Speculation is already building around potential Gen 10 games, special edition trading cards, and even remakes of earlier-generation titles.
